Output 99964b907d171c5a46a46a1ea79ab4b723f31aef0f26054c9bd7affd099a418b:83

value
28632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82c25d23930a74a6c4ba73761ff3ebd019a6d2a89c382390f9dfbf8474225ad3
address
bc1pstp96gunpf62d396wdmplult6qv6d54gnsuz8y8em7lcgapzttfs0eu0q2
transaction
99964b907d171c5a46a46a1ea79ab4b723f31aef0f26054c9bd7affd099a418b
spent
true